Output 89665c52bc7123bba098774955976cf20d1cdb529a513b393f2bada7d0ec1431:0

value
20275570
script pubkey
OP_0 OP_PUSHBYTES_20 ac610b8c514e25c26c80c5ab4ea437635ed35c6b
address
bc1q43sshrz3fcjuymyqck45afphvd0dxhrtwetk7u
transaction
89665c52bc7123bba098774955976cf20d1cdb529a513b393f2bada7d0ec1431